I don't know if I'm alone in this problem, but several times each day I click on a thumbnail image (usually in the "New Images" gallery), and the page opens, all the information displays, but the image remains blank - no error, and the page says it has downloaded completely. If I hit F5 to refresh the page the same thing happens regardless of the number of times I try to refresh the page. Today the problem is occurring with MadMaven's "This Sucks!" image. If I click on the blank square to try to open the image full-size, It opens the browser, and starts downloading. The little blue bar creeps across the bottom of the (Mozilla) browser's status bar, then it stops at about 70% and never completes. I can close all browsers, clear my cache, restart my browser, and try again and I receive the same result. If I try again later in the day I am usually able to open the image normally.

Has this happened to anyone else? If so it's a website issue, and we should notify our noble leader. Otherwise it's my problem, and I'll just have to resolve it myself.
